Fast glycolytic fibres
1. Large diameter and large volumes of glycogen: The large diameter enables the fibres to produce contractile force.
2. Uses anaerobic glycosis to get ATP source: This works in low supply of oxygen which is where it derive ATP from during glycosis.
3. Break down ATP fast and contract fast as well: This occurs at the time when they fatigue quickly.
Slow oxidative fibres:
1. They possess a very large volume of mitochondria
2. They resist fatigue: This type of fibre type has the highest resistance to fatigue. They can function for long periods without being fatigued.
3. These are made up of muscles with long contraction duration.
Explanation:
These are examples of muscle fibres. The third one is known as the fast oxidative.
The slow oxidative and fast oxidative uses aerobic respiration while fast glycolytic uses anaerobic respiration.

The correct answer would be, Conflict Theory.
Conflict Theory would most likely examine this and draw a connection between criminal punishment and class.
Explanation:
White collar crimes are the crimes committed by businessmen and government officials, or people with power. People committing white collar crimes are often respectable and reputed in the society. Such crimes may include:
- Money Laundering
- Wage Theft
- Bribery
- Insider Trading
- Identity Theft, and many more
According to the Conflict Theory, life is a competition between the distribution of power, resources and inequality. When other people see such inequalities, the conflicts are generated within the society.
White collar crimes are related to theories of conflict, as people with power tend to do crimes due to their power, position and status. Conflict Theory draws a connection between criminal punishment and class of those people.
